As Manovich states, the layering of information on top of architectural features is not new, as we can see, for instance, in any medieval cathedral, were biblical narrations were overlaid to the facades. Nevertheless, “The Phenomenon of the dynamic multimedia information in these environments is new”. Anyway, I would say that the speed of this [...]

Is the multimedia information new, or is it merely the technology? Borrowing Lev’s own examples of churches, there is plenty of evidence of specific design meant to create specific multi-media effects (i.e. sight and sound effects) through smart use of shape and scale. The projections of sound and the projections of shadow and light are [...]
